Role Overview & Responsibilities

Gough and Kelly, an NSI Gold company, is a premier provider of security products and services and has served the north of England for over three decades.

We now have an excellent opportunity for an enthusiastic and motivated Apprentice Security Engineer to join the team in Leeds, to assist in the installation, service, and maintenance of security systems at various sites, and to apply learning from both academic and practical information.

The position:

  • Permanent, full-time
  • 40 hours per week
  • To undertake the City & Guilds; Level 3 Fire, Emergency and Security Systems Technician apprenticeship at Bradford College (candidates would be required to make own way to/from college once a week)

Gough and Kelly value hard work and commitment, and in return, we are committed to giving back to our employees. We have an excellent and ever-growing benefits package to set you on the right path from the day you join us:

  • Enhanced sick pay
  • Holiday entitlement – increasing to 24 days, with length of service, plus 8 bank holidays
  • Employee Assistance Programme (EAP)
  • Private Healthcare Scheme (with length of service)
  • Employee Benefits Programme (with length of service)
  • Ongoing training and mentoring, with development and progression opportunities
  • Pension Scheme
  • Cycle to Work Scheme
  • Company social events

Main duties:

  • To assist the engineers in the installation, service and maintenance of CCTV, intruder alarms and access control systems.
  • To meet with clients and ensure first-class service when on-site.
  • To complete company paperwork accurately and to complete timesheets within the required time frame.
  • To take responsibility for applying all college learning to your role, and to understand the combination of academic and practical elements of security engineering.

The ideal candidate will:

  • Be driven and willing to learn
  • Possess excellent customer service skills and experience
  • Have strong verbal and written communication skills
  • Be willing and flexible to travel
  • Be reliable and punctual
  • Possess a UK driving licence
